This volume of Rilke’s letters covers the years from the completion of The Notebooks of Malte Laurids Brigge to Rilke’s death in December 1926, nearly five years after he had written the Duino Elegies and the Sonnets to Orpheus, his last major works.

There are important letters here to Muzot, Lou Andreas-Salome, to Princess Marie of Thurn and Taxis Hohenlohe, and many others. The most significant of the
Wartime Letters: 1914-1921 are also included. An Introduction briefly traces the development of Rilke’s work during these years; the Notes provide the necessary framework of biographical details and point up significant references to the poetry.

M.D.H. Norton (1894–1985) was cofounder of W. W. Norton & Company, now the oldest and largest publisher owned wholly by its employees.
